An Instagram Tour of Jackson Hole

I haven’t been to every winter resort around the world, but I’m pretty sure Jackson Hole will always be one of my Top 5 favorite places for a ski vacation. The white stuff fell each day of our visit, with cushy powder at the top illustrating exactly why I finally bought that new pair of fat skis last year.

Snow remains in the forecast for the next several days, making up for lost ground during a dry January. If you have the flexibility, book a trip now. Perhaps the following few photos will feed the appetite.

(Of course, those in the Silverton area are doing just fine after 48-hour snow totals of 48″.)
